Kaizer Chiefs football club is reeling from the tragic loss of defender Luke Fleurs, who was fatally shot during a failed carjacking attempt in Florida, Johannesburg, on Wednesday, April 3, 2024.

Fleurs, aged 24, was reportedly gunned down during the harrowing incident, sending shockwaves through the football community.
While Chiefs’ media officer Vina Maphosa refrained from confirming Fleurs’ death, stating he was not authorized to do so by the family, reports of the tragic event have sent shockwaves throughout the football world.
Fleurs, who had recently joined Chiefs after parting ways with SuperSport United earlier in the season, was undergoing successful trials with the club.

Despite signing a two-year deal with Chiefs in October 2023, Fleurs tragically passed away before making his official debut for the team. His untimely death has robbed the football community of a promising talent, recognized for his exceptional abilities on the field.
The talented defender had previously been awarded the prestigious 2021/22 PSL Young Player of the Season accolade, a testament to his skill and potential. Additionally, Fleurs had represented South Africa at the youth level, showcasing his talent on the international stage.
As news of Fleurs’ passing reverberates throughout the football fraternity, tributes pour in from fans, teammates, and officials alike, mourning the loss of a rising star whose career was tragically cut short.
